Caring for Your Painted Wine Glasses

Preserving the Beauty of Your Painted Wine Glasses

Owning a set of hand painted wine glasses is not just about the aesthetic pleasure they bring to your collection, but also about maintaining their beauty over time. Proper care is essential to ensure that the intricate glass painting remains vibrant and intact.

Gentle Cleaning Techniques

When it comes to cleaning your painted glasses, gentle is the keyword. Avoid using harsh detergents or abrasive sponges that could damage the paint. Instead, opt for a mild dish soap and a soft cloth or sponge. Hand washing is recommended over dishwashing, as the high temperatures and detergents in dishwashers can be too harsh for the delicate paint.

Storage Tips for Longevity

Proper storage is crucial to prevent scratches and fading. Consider using a soft cloth or individual glass sleeves to protect each glass in the set. If you have stemless wine glasses, ensure they are stored upright to avoid any unnecessary pressure on the painted surface. Regularly rotating the glasses in your display can also help prevent uneven fading from light exposure.

Handling with Care

While painted wine glasses are designed to be functional, they require a bit more care than regular glassware. Handle them with care, especially when serving or cleaning. This is particularly important for glasses with intricate designs like cherry blossom or blue hydrangea motifs, where the paint might be more susceptible to wear.

Regular Inspections

Make it a habit to regularly inspect your painted wine glasses for any signs of wear or damage. Early detection of chips or fading can help you take corrective measures in time, preserving the beauty of your glassware for years to come.
